9. Besides the administrative punishment, what kind of system implemented by the traffic control department of the public security organ to the driver who violated the traffic regulations?

A. violation registration system

B. mileage reward system

C. mandatory write-off system

D. accumulated penalty points system

Answer:D

11. When a vehicle stops temporarily in a snowy day, the driver should turn on _______.

A. The head and tail fog light

B. The reserve light

C. The high beam light

D. The hazard lights

Answer:D

17. After a vehicle enters the ramp, the driver should swiftly increase the speed to more than 60 kilometers per hour.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:B

18. Whats the role of the prohibitive sign?

A. indicate the vehicles to go ahead

B. warn danger ahead

C. prohibit or restrict from doing

D. tell the direction information

Answer:C

23. In the course of making a U turn, the driver should strictly control the speed, carefully observe the road conditions before and behind the vehicle, and may advance or reverse only if it is safe to do so.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

25. When encountering disabled people obstructing the traffic, the driver should voluntarily reduce speed and yield.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A
